多个维度的度量 TOTAL 的计算成员
Calculated Member for the TOTAL of a measure for multiple Dimensions
我正在尝试将一个度量与一个计算的度量合计为
CALCULATE;
CREATE MEMBER CURRENTCUBE.[Measures].[Total On Hand Amount]
AS ([Warehouses].[Warehouses].[All],[Measures].[On Hand Amount]),
FORMAT_STRING = "#,#",
VISIBLE = 1;
当我选择了仓库维度时,这是有效的,但我想使其动态化,以便它也适用于任何其他 dimensions/hierarchies,而无需将它们添加到代码中。
感谢任何帮助!!
我想你想使用 Root
CALCULATE;
CREATE MEMBER CURRENTCUBE.[Measures].[Total On Hand Amount]
AS AGGREGATE(Root(),[Measures].[On Hand Amount]),
FORMAT_STRING = "#,#",
VISIBLE = 1;
这是一个小例子:
我正在尝试将一个度量与一个计算的度量合计为
CALCULATE;
CREATE MEMBER CURRENTCUBE.[Measures].[Total On Hand Amount]
AS ([Warehouses].[Warehouses].[All],[Measures].[On Hand Amount]),
FORMAT_STRING = "#,#",
VISIBLE = 1;
当我选择了仓库维度时,这是有效的,但我想使其动态化,以便它也适用于任何其他 dimensions/hierarchies,而无需将它们添加到代码中。
感谢任何帮助!!
我想你想使用 Root
CALCULATE;
CREATE MEMBER CURRENTCUBE.[Measures].[Total On Hand Amount]
AS AGGREGATE(Root(),[Measures].[On Hand Amount]),
FORMAT_STRING = "#,#",
VISIBLE = 1;
这是一个小例子: